Catalog description

A course designed to teach the fundamentals of investigation; crime scene preservation of evidence; scientific aids; modus operandi; sources of information, interviews and interrogation; ethical challenges; surveillance; follow-up and case preparation; constitutional issues; and the role of the investigator in the trial process.
